Job Title: Clean Water Design Manager
Salary: Circa 60,000 - 80,000 (dependent on experience)
Location: Newport, Wales
Type: Permanent | Hybrid



About the Role:

Our client is looking for a dynamic Water Design Manager to lead a multi-disciplinary team in delivering a clean water programme. Reporting to the Design Manager, you will work closely with technical discipline leads and the client leadership team to ensure projects are delivered on time, within budget, and to the highest standards of technical excellence. This role offers the opportunity to shape future-proofed services, embrace innovation in digital technology, and mentor the next generation of industry talent.



About Our Client:

Our client is a leading engineering, management, and development consultancy, recognised as one of the UK's top employers and a champion of inclusivity. Their Water Consultancy Division is at the forefront of tackling water and wastewater challenges, providing expertise across the full project life cycle-from advisory services and feasibility studies to construction support and supervision.



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ead and manage a multi-disciplinary team to deliver the clean water programme.
  • Ensure projects meet key milestones, budgets, and quality standards.
  • Work closely with internal teams and client leadership in a collaborative environment.
  • Support bids, fee proposals, and service offers.
  • Oversee technical deliverables, calculations, and reports.
  • Drive innovation and sustainability within project solutions.


What Our Client is Looking For:

Essential:

  • Chartered Engineer (CEng) with a recognised professional institution.
  • Strong technical leadership experience in the UK water sector.
  • Proven track record in feasibility and outline design solutions.
  • Excellent communication sk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ively.
  • A passion for client engagement and relationship management.

Desirable:

  • Experience in team building and mentoring junior staff.
  • Knowledge of water sector treatment and sustainability challenges.
  • Strong technical report writing skills.


What Our Client Offers:

  • Health & Wellbeing: Private medical insurance, health cash plans, and wellbeing support.
  • Financial Benefits: Employer-matched pension contributions (4.5% - 7%), life assurance (4-6x salary), and income protection schemes.
  • Work-Life Balance: Minimum 33-35 days holiday (including public holidays) with buy/sell options.
  • Family Support: Enhanced parental leave, including 26 weeks' paid maternity/adoption leave and two weeks' paid paternity leave.
  • Career Development: Professional institution subscriptions, mentoring, and training opportunities.
  • Inclusive Culture: Employee networks supporting LGBTQ+, gender, race and ethnicity, disability, and parents/carers communities.


Eligibility:

Applicants must be eligible to work in the UK.
